Use shortcut2-2.0.1 and watch your mem size drop 3mg or so.
upgrade mzscript to .9 and loose ckhotspots
Refactor your scripting to do everything with mzscript and get rid of textedit.
label, popup2, mzscript, and jdesk probably use up the most memory, but you can't necessarily do anything about it while keeping the same look and functionality.
For lsxcommand, trim your engines.list file. The default is huge and you're probably not using most of it.

Don't forget NetLoadModule and your hotkey module. Getting rid of NLM and (x)label should help most. You could also disable LSUseSystemDDE (restart litestep.exe after that, don't just !recycle).
But don't say that you don't want to remove label because you need its features. You can't cut any program's memory usage down without losing any functionality. Any feature that you add will add to the memory usage.
EDIT: Before I forget, loading label won't really use too much memory, but using its [vars] might do that.
Hm, I don't think there are any guides for removing the dependency on textedit... Understand how $vars$ work, and mzscript's varsave capability. If you're just using it to change things like "setting true" to "setting false", this is pretty easy. The main trick is to use *varFile and include on the same file. Then you can just set the new value and it'll be changed when you recycle.
